Rolling 30 OD Shell

Was getting quality template to check shell profile and as the employee backed up his left heel got caught on a piece of metal in the floor. This caused the employee to lose his balance and stumbled backwards hurting his left knee.

Injury to employees left knee

Piece of metal in the floor

An employee was rolling a [REDACTED] OD [REDACTED]. He went to get his quality template to check the shell profile. As the employee backed up his left heel got caught on a piece of metal in the floor causing him to lose his balance. EE stumbled backwards
